President Barack Obama says he is in favor of choosing a business leader for his economic team in a second term if talented executives can be convinced the U.S. Senate confirmation process isn’t too disheartening.
“Not only is it something I’m considering, I’d love to do it,” the president said on Bloomberg Television in his first interview since winning re-election. “It’s something I would have loved to have done in the first term.”
